In traditional Chamorro barbecue, chicken and ribs are marinated for a full day in soy sauce, vinegar, lemon, sugar, onion, and garlicbefore being grilled over an open fire, often fueled bytangan-tanganwood. Vegetable oil (for frying) The Chamorro are the original inhabitants of Guam, who are believed to have lived on the island for more than 4,000 years.iThe spelling of the word Chamorro has gone througha number ofdifferent variations, including Tsamoru,Chamorru, andCamuru. Most recently, the spelling CHamoru was adopted by theKumisionIFinoCHamoru(Chamorro Language Commission). There are two main types of hot donne, or peppers, native to Guam: Donnesali with small, bright red and very pungent fruit and donne tiau a long, red and pungent pepper, according to Mari Marutani, a professor at the University of Guams College of Natural and Applied Sciences.
